  • The SO302-SW "Tiger" is a second-generation, fully rugged server with an integrated 14 port intelligent Layer II or III switch. It is designed to provide an Enterprise level of Layer II and Layer III switch functions with the highest level of server-class performance possible in a fully ruggedized, conduction-cooled system, operating up to -40°C to +85°C (-20°C to +75°C standard) temperature range. The Tiger utilizes individual MIL circular locking connectors for each Ethernet port thus providing the ultimate rugged interconnect with maximum flexibility. The Tiger is targeted for applications where an ultra-fast, multi-core CPU is needed with vast amounts of high-speed, ECC-protected RAM controlling 12 Gigabit Ethernet devices (24 optional, lose high-speed I/O and locking connectors) with packet snooping and switching functions with customizable rules. The SO302-SW supports 10 physical CPU cores with Hyper-Threading for a total of 20 logical cores, each operating up to 2.4GHz with ability to TurboBoost up to 3.0GHz. To harvest this incredible CPU performance, the CPU is coupled with up to 128GB of DDR3 RAM organized in four banks. Each RAM bank consists of two DDR3 DIMM arrays with error correcting code (ECC). The ECC RAM provides 2-bit error detection with 1-bit correction and up to 1600 mega-transfers per second (MTS) between CPU and memory.

  • The SB1002-MD “Golden-Eyes” is a fifth-generation, ultra-rugged, small, lightweight computer system. It is designed to allow two different domains (red and black) to operate independently in the same system, while providing the highest level of workstation performance possible in a fully ruggedized, conduction-cooled, sealed system, operating up to -40°C to +85°C (-20°C to +75°C standard). The Golden-Eyes system is targeted for applications where classified and unclassified software need to operate simultaneously with an NSA-approved architecture for multi-domain applications in a small, ultra-rugged enclosure with the highest possible performance, per dollar and per watt, while utilizing rugged interconnects to provide a fully sealed system and sharing only DC power. 
     
    The Golden-Eyes supports the latest, most power-efficient Intel® Core™ i7 Haswell processor with Hyper-Threading for a total of 8 logical cores, each operating at up to 2.4GHz and the ability to TurboBoost up to 3.4GHz. To harvest this incredible CPU performance, the CPU is coupled with up to 32GB of RAM organized in two banks that support Error Correcting Code (ECC). The ECC RAM provides 2-bit error detection and 1-bit error correction and supports up to 1600 Mega Transfers per Second (MTS) between CPU and memory.
